What does KMS-R@1n.exe do?

KMS-R@1n.exe is a simple file that helps a malicious application to work the way it is programmed to. It has been found that it usually hides in C:\Windows folder; however, it does not mean that it is a system file. If you use Windows 10/8/7 or Windows XP, its size will be about 26, 112 bytes. As you can see, it is not that hard to recognize it. If you have already detected this file, it might be very true that your PC is infected with a Trojan infection. If you do not do anything and let it stay, it might steal your banking information, it might download all kinds of malicious applications on your PC without your permission, and it might enable hackers to connect to your computer remotely. Also, you might notice one day that your computer is slower than it used to be, it crashes and freezes, and it even restarts periodically without your permission. These are the symptoms showing that there is a Trojan installed and you need to delete KMS-R@1n.exe right now to get rid of it. When you remove KMS-R@1n.exe from your system, it is very likely that Trojan will no longer work on your computer as well.
